Are nipple piercings worth it? by Feather_2864 in piercing

[–]NavigatingRShips 1 point2 points  (0 children)

It’s a very individual thing. I’ve had mine done twice. The piercing pain was fine (it sucked, but I’ve had worse), and it only lasted a few seconds.

They’re finicky during healing. I wore a bra the first time and had a harder time healing them (not everyone has that experience). It took about two years for it to heal completely. But I love it. It’s one of my favourite piercings (so much that I had it re pierced).
